【个人AI探索学习记录之claudecode】
系列文章目录
AI探索之claudecode
文章目录
前言
AI领域近年来涌现出多个爆火工具,涵盖代码生成、自然语言处理和多模态交互。如claudecode、openclaw、codex等等,紧跟AI潮流进行探索。在windows端和wsl linux端都进行了尝试,日常工作主要面向linux,因此在此只介绍wsl端的探索,并且探索命令行工具claudecode。文中有些探索方式出自鱼皮教程
AI 编程工具的 3 大类型(引用自鱼皮)
零代码平台
在浏览器里打开就能用,不需要安装任何软件,不需要懂任何代码。适合完全零基础的新手、想快速做出原型的同学。
代表工具:Bolt.new、Lovable、秒哒
优势:上手快、所见即所得、自动部署
局限:功能相对简单,复杂项目可能力不从心

AI 代码编辑器
需要下载安装,界面像传统代码编辑器,但内置了强大的 AI 助手。适合有一定基础、想深入学习 Vibe Coding、需要做复杂项目的人。
代表工具:Cursor、Windsurf、Antigravity、Augment Code
优势:功能强大、灵活度高、适合大型项目
局限:需要一定学习成本,对新手不够友好

命令行工具
在终端里通过命令行和 AI 对话,适合有编程基础的开发者、喜欢命令行的极客。
代表工具:Claude Code、Gemini CLI
优势:效率极高、自动化程度强、成本可控
局限:需要一定技术基础,新手不建议使用

提示:以下是本篇文章正文内容,下面案例可供参考
一、caludecode是什么?
Claude 是 Anthropic 公司推出的 AI 模型系列,一直被公认为编程能力最强的 AI 模型。2025 年推出的 Claude 4.5 系列已经很强了,而 2026 年 2 月发布的 Claude Opus 4.6 又把能力拉到了新高度。
Claude 4 系列主要有两个版本线:Opus 是顶配版本,编程能力最强,但速度相对较慢,价格也更高;Sonnet 是平衡版本,在性能和速度之间取得了很好的平衡,性价比最高。
核心功能
代码生成
支持多种编程语言(如 Python、JavaScript、Java 等),根据用户描述的需求生成可运行的代码。例如输入“用 Python 实现快速排序”,即可输出完整算法代码。
代码解释
对复杂代码段提供逐行或整体逻辑的解读,帮助开发者理解他人代码或学习新技术。例如粘贴一段 SQL 查询语句,claudecode 可解释其执行流程。
错误调试
识别代码中的语法或逻辑错误,并提供修复建议。例如当用户提交报错的 Python 代码时,工具会定位问题行并给出修改方案。
二、大模型选择
市面上的 AI 模型已经非常丰富了。按照来源和定位,可以分为 3 大阵营:
国际顶尖模型:Claude、ChatGPT、Gemini 这三大巨头
国产优秀模型:DeepSeek、智谱 GLM、通义千问、Kimi 等性价比之选
还有开源模型:Llama、Qwen 等,需要一定技术能力自己部署
本文主要使用claude sonnet 4.6模型和GLM-5模型
三、WSL通过电脑网卡直接上网并使用代理
配置步骤:
创建或编辑配置文件:在C:\Users<你的用户名>.wslconfig中添加以下内容:
[wsl2]
networkingMode=mirrored
dnsTunneling=true
autoProxy=true
firewall=true
重启WSL应用配置:
wsl --shutdown
wsl --update
wsl # 重新启动WSL
测试:不要用ping测试,使用以下命令:
curl -I https://www.google.com # 测试HTTP连接
四、安装步骤
1.安装node.js
Claude Code 需要 Node.js ≥ 18,Ubuntu 24.04 默认仓库中的版本可能较旧,推荐使用 NodeSource 安装最新版:
# 使用 NodeSource 安装 Node.js 22(推荐,需科学上网)
curl -fsSL https://deb.nodesource.com/setup_22.x | sudo -E bash -
sudo apt install -y nodejs
# 验证安装
node --version # 应显示 v22.x.x
npm --version # 应显示 10.x.x
2.安装Claude Code
# 全局安装 Claude Code
sudo npm install -g @anthropic-ai/claude-code
3.配置Claude模型
claude sonnet 4.6模型
地址和KEY的用法:
export ANTHROPIC_BASE_URL=https://www.heiyucode.com
export ANTHROPIC_AUTH_TOKEN=
4.配置国内GLM模型
更改.setting.json
{
"env": {
"ANTHROPIC_AUTH_TOKEN": "",
"ANTHROPIC_BASE_URL": "https://open.bigmodel.cn/api/anthropic",
"ANTHROPIC_MODEL": "glm-5",
"ANTHROPIC_SMALL_FAST_MODEL": "glm-5"
},
"mcpServers": {
"powerpoint": {
"command": "/home/sky/miniconda3/bin/ppt_mcp_server",
"args": [],
"env": {}
}
}
}
5.验证Claude Code安装
输入claude进入claudecode:


四、工具使用
4.安装skills
添加官方技能市场
/plugin marketplace add anthropics/skills

安装example-skills
查看包含的skills
安装一个frontend-design试试水
并让AI设计一个网站,看到自动加载了skill
效果确实不错!!
总结
提示:这里对文章进行总结:
以上就是今天的内容
AtomGit 是由开放原子开源基金会联合 CSDN 等生态伙伴共同推出的新一代开源与人工智能协作平台。平台坚持“开放、中立、公益”的理念,把代码托管、模型共享、数据集托管、智能体开发体验和算力服务整合在一起,为开发者提供从开发、训练到部署的一站式体验。
更多推荐


所有评论(0)